What is the meaning of Recess?

A depressed, hollow, or indented space; also, a hole or opening.

A small space created by building part of a wall further back from the rest; a niche.

The place in a prison where the communal lavatories are located.

A hidden, innermost, or inaccessible place or part of a place.

    A temporary stoppage of an activity; a break, a pause.

    A period of time when the proceedings of a committee, court of law, parliament, or other official body are temporarily suspended.

    A time away from studying during the school day for a meal or recreation.

    An act of retiring or withdrawing; a moving back.

    A decree or resolution of the diet of the Holy Roman Empire or the Hanseatic League.
